Broken track
Bifold doors can open and fold within a track that sits on top of the header frame. These doors are frequently knocked off track and need adjustments or replacement. If your bi-fold doors aren't sliding they could be experiencing a problem with either the track or pivot pin. These issues can be resolved by using a few tools and a bit of effort.
First, you will need to take the doors off of their tracks. This can be accomplished by pushing down on pivot pins and then lifting the doors off of their anchor brackets. Once the doors are lifted off, you can easily examine their condition. The majority of bi fold door repair near me-folding doors are pivot pins and spring-loaded guides which can be easily replaced. You can purchase replacements for these components at the majority of hardware or home improvement stores.
Once you have the components installed, you can put the track at the top and bottom. Start by removing your old track. Remove the screws and separate the track from the header. Then, drill a new 1 1/2 inch screw to join the track frame. Then screw in the new track beginning at the first hole and working up to the last one.
If your bifold door is having trouble closing and opening, you may need to raise the bottom of the track. This is because the carpet is rubbing up against the bottom of track. To raise the track begin by loosening the screws that hold the bottom bracket, and then move the pivot hold to the position that will straighten the door. Once the track is adjusted it is now possible to move the doors to their proper positions. Slide first the top door before moving to the bottom.
Leaning doors
Many homeowners face the problem of a creaking door. This is typically caused by an inconsistency between the hinges and the jamb of the door. The most popular method to fix this is to remove the door, sand down and refinish. However, this can be an extremely time-consuming and laborious project. Another alternative is to use a shim to correct the misalignment.
First, you'll need to take the hinges off the door. Then, use a woodworker's level to check the alignment of your hinges. If you notice that any of the areas are not level, you will have to put shims in the hinges and jamb. Once you have added the shims, you can reattach the doors and recheck their alignment. This will aid in spreading the weight of the door evenly and prevent future sagging.
Over time, house frames can shift and get out of place due to shifting foundations or different kinds of soil. This can cause doors to become out of plumb and sag against the frame. To fix this by tightening the hinge screws is an easy solution. It is essential to tighten these carefully to avoid damaging the screw head or opening the joint.
If the screw is loose Try tightening it using a wrench instead of a screwdriver to avoid over-tightening. If the screw is pulling away from the hole in a straight line and you are not sure how to fill it or pack it. You can do this by using wood glue as well as a small hammer and some toothpicks that have been coated in wood glue. You can also cover the hole with a shim which gives the hinge additional strength and stability.
